/**
19
 * @brief A polynomial function of time of degree one, that is a linear function
20
 *
21
 * The size of the parameters \f$\mathbf{u}\f$ is twice the size of the control
22
 * input \f$\mathbf{w}\f$. The first half of \f$\mathbf{u}\f$ represents the
23
 * value of w at time 0. The second half of \f$\mathbf{u}\f$ represents the
24
 * value of \f$\mathbf{w}\f$ at time 0.5.
25
 *
26
 * The main computations are carried out in `calc`, `multiplyByJacobian` and
27
 * `multiplyJacobianTransposeBy`, where the former computes control input
28
 * \f$\mathbf{w}\in\mathbb{R}^{nw}\f$ from a set of control parameters
29
 * \f$\mathbf{u}\in\mathbb{R}^{nu}\f$ where `nw` and `nu` represent the
30
 * dimension of the control inputs and parameters, respectively, and the latter
31
 * defines useful operations across the Jacobian of the control-parametrization
32
 * model. Finally, `params` allows us to obtain the control parameters from the
33
 * control input, i.e., it is the inverse of `calc`. Note that
34
 * `multiplyByJacobian` and `multiplyJacobianTransposeBy` requires to run `calc`
35
 * first.
36
 *
37
 * \sa `ControlParametrizationAbstractTpl`, `calc()`, `calcDiff()`,
38
 * `createData()`, `params`, `multiplyByJacobian`, `multiplyJacobianTransposeBy`
39
 */
